Escalation. If ParityScope reports a sustained mismatch across more than three partner hotel chains, first confirm the feed from the Dunmarle aggregator is current. If the feed is healthy and discrepancies persist past thirty minutes, declare a severity-two incident and page the pricing duty rotation. For release-blocking parity failures, notify the on-call lead directly at this address.

billing contact of yawip-yadup = druath.casdor@nelvrolabs.internal

**Handover: Checkout load testing (Perrow → Astley)**

For this week's sync: the Loomgate checkout flow sustained 1,800 orders/minute in Tuesday's run before the payment-intent service began shedding requests. I've parked the test harness with the ramp profile saved, so the next run can start from the same baseline. Remaining work: rerun with the new connection-pool settings and capture p99 latency per step. Scenario configs, result dashboards, and the run schedule are on the internal page here.

wiki page, tahaf-tajog: https://jira.ordindyn.corp/pipeline

Hey — the Striderline chip readers at the Dunmoor Marathon staging depot are rejecting firmware build 4.2.1 with a signature mismatch. Looks like the build box signed with the retired spring key after last week's rotation. Readers won't load unsigned firmware in the field, obviously, so we're blocked on re-signing before race weekend. Can you re-sign 4.2.1 and push? The current valid signing key is below.

rollout seal: bky4_x7Gc